Water Resistivity Measurement.

Water resistivity can be an excellent method of measuring the purity of water because resistivity checks for the concentration of ions in the water. Resistivity rises when conductivity falls. Just as with keeping past water quality analysis reports, it is also a good idea to keep water resistivity monitoring reports. This will establish the baseline, which will act as as alert if there is ever an anomaly.
